What is UV-C or Germicidal UV Light?
Germicidal UV or UV-C belongs to the ultraviolet spectrum best known for its capacity to suspend pathogens like infections as well as bacteria. It utilizes details wavelengths of the ultraviolet range, normally in between 200 to 280 nanometers.
Germicidal UV is typically made use of to decontaminate surfaces and also spaces. COVID-19 can survive on particular surfaces for as much as three days, so it’s important to decontaminate at normal periods.
The science behind germicidal UV has been around for a lengthy time, it hasn’t been widely made use of till recently. The CDC as well as FEMA began to back the usage in health centers in the very early 2000s. Ever since, several clinical testimonials have kept in mind the efficiency and use has entered the last 13 years.

One 2008 research tested the efficiency of the VIOlight, a $US30 tooth brush sanitizer that claims to clear your toothbrush of disease-forming germs. The study discovered that, compared to a toothbrush that had actually not been treated with ultraviolet light, the VIOlight eliminated 86% even more colony-forming units of S. salivarius, lactobacilli, and E. coli. These germs can create strep throat, digestive issues, and also a number of other ailments.
Sanitizing wands allow you to wave UVC light over anything you may want to disinfect, consisting of counters, bedding, and steering wheels. The sticks can be made use of anywhere, work within secs, and also are often used by tourists worried concerning things like hotel room cleanliness.
A 2014 research study evaluated the efficiency of these portable sticks and located that they killed 100% of commonly-found bacteria within five seconds and suspended 90% of spore-forming bacteria, which are tougher to kill, within 40 seconds.

Does UV Light Kill Germs?
The three major kinds of UV rays are UVA, UVB, and also UVC. Because UVC rays have the quickest wavelength, and therefore highest energy, they are qualified of killing microorganisms and also viruses, additionally called microorganisms. UV Sterilizer Hospital
UVC light has a wavelength of between 200 and 400 nanometres (nm). It is extremely reliable at decontamination due to the fact that it ruins the molecular bonds that hold together the DNA of microorganisms as well as viruses, consisting of “superbugs,” which have created a stronger resistance to prescription antibiotics.
Effective UVC light has been consistently utilized to sanitize medical devices as well as medical facility rooms. A research study that included 21,000 individuals who remained overnight in a room where somebody had been formerly dealt with located that sanitizing a health center space with UV light in enhancement to standard methods of cleansing cut transmission of drug-resistant germs by 30%.
This is partially since UVC light can efficiently sanitize hard-to-clean spaces as well as crannies. UVC light likewise functions by destroying the DNA of pathogens, that makes it reliable against “superbugs.”.
Scientists have recently been dealing with narrow-spectrum UVC rays (207-222 nm). This kind of UVC light kills bacteria and viruses without passing through the outer cell layer of human skin.

A 2017 research study revealed that 222 nm UVC light eliminated methicillin-resistant Staphylococcus aureus (MRSA) bacteria simply as successfully as a 254 nm UVC light, which would certainly be hazardous to human beings. This research study was duplicated in 2018 on the H1N1 virus, and also narrow-spectrum UVC light was once again found to be reliable at eliminating the virus.
This has especially crucial effects for public wellness given that the possibility of non-toxic above UV illumination in public areas could significantly reduce the transmission of diseases.
Eliminating microorganisms and infections with UV light is particularly reliable due to the fact that it kills germs regardless of medicine resistance and without harmful chemicals. It is additionally effective versus all bacteria, even newly-emerging pathogen pressures.
Can Germicidal UV Light Kill Viruses?
Germicidal UV lights can really transform the DNA and RNA of infections as well as germs, damaging their ability to duplicate. UV Sterilizer Hospital
Infections are not living organisms, so germicidal UV can not technically “kill” them. Instead, we can state germicidal UV “suspends” infections, while it does kill germs.
Microorganisms may be resistant to various other points like anti-biotics, however can not construct up a resistance to UV light.
Can UV Lights Inactivate COVID-19?
Since this is an unique (or brand-new) coronavirus, screening is extremely minimal but is currently recurring. The framework of COVID-19 is various from previous infections. Therefore, there is not nearly enough information to state that UV lights can suspend COVID-19.
Microorganisms can be ranked based on their tolerance to anti-bacterials, like germicidal UV. Course 3 viruses are the simplest to get rid of.
Products that are able to inactivate even more resilient infections like tiny and also big non-enveloped infections (Class 1 & 2 infections) need to additionally be efficient against surrounded viruses like coronaviruses. Numerous UV product suppliers state their products can kill most Class 1 infections.
Based upon this details, germicidal UV is believed to be reliable against COVID-19.
Is UV Light Safe?
Current researches reveal certain wavelengths of UV light may be safer than others while still targeting bacteria and viruses.
Far-UVC lights make use of a slim variety of UV-C wavelengths, from 207 to 222 nm.
Far-UVC is thought to be just as efficient at eliminating germs as higher series of UV-C light, but much less harmful to our skin and also eyes.
One research study in particular concentrates on the use of far-UVC light. The study ended that 222 nm UV can suspend microorganisms yet not pass through the skin.

How Do UV Light Sanitizers Work?
On the UV light spectrum there are UV-A, B, and also C lights. Just the UV-C light can kill bacteria, claims Philip Tierno, PhD, a clinical professor in the department of pathology at New York University Langone Medical Center.
” This light has an array of effectiveness, which conflicts and also destroys the nucleic acids of microorganisms and also other microorganisms,” Tierno explained, adding that the variety of light can additionally disrupt proteins in the microbes by killing specific amino acids. They function best on smooth surface areas and also have limitations, Tierno suggested.
” UV-C penetrates superficially, and the light can not obtain into crannies and also nooks,” he described. That includes points like buttons or phone cases, which are lined with holes. If a germ is enclosed within a food bit, for example, the UV light won’t be able to access it.
” These eliminate microbes rapidly,” Michael Schmidt said. “But when your tool comes out, it’s just as risk-free as its last encounter.” To put it simply, making use of the UV light sanitizer does not certify you to obtain dirty and disregard feasible new bacteria on the phone.

Are UV Light Sanitizers Safe?
A certain range of ultraviolet light, far UV-C, “effectively suspends microorganisms without damage to subjected mammalian skin,” according to a study published in Nature. “This is because, as a result of its strong absorbance in biological products, far-UVC light can not pass through even the external (non living) layers of human skin or eye; nonetheless, because infections as well as bacteria are of micrometer or smaller measurements, far-UVC can pass through as well as inactivate them.”. Just How UV Light Kills Microbes
Viruses don’t recreate by themselves, yet they do have hereditary product, either DNA or RNA. They recreate by attaching to cells and also injecting their DNA. Some viruses break out of the contaminated cell (this type of recreation is called the lytic cycle), while others merge into the infected cell, reproducing whenever that cell splits (lysogenic).
If you’ve ever gotten a sunburn, you’ve had a preference of just how UV light eliminates infections: UV light can harm DNA. A DNA molecule is constructed from 2 hairs bound with each other by four bases, adenine (A), cytosine (C), guanine (G), as well as thymine (T). These bases are like an alphabet, as well as their series types instructions for cells to reproduce.
UV light can trigger thymine bases to fuse with each other, rushing the DNA sequence and basically tossing a wrench into the machinery. Because the DNA sequence is no more right, it can no much longer reproduce appropriately. This is how UV light annihilates viruses, by destroying their ability to replicate.
